Solution Overview

Problem

Traditional card games face challenges in gathering multiple players due to busy lifestyles, and online games lack the interaction of physical cards, such as drawing and discarding, which reduces the gaming experience.

Innovation Solution

A gaming system and table that utilize gaming cards with recognition codes, an invisible light source, and an image capturing device to generate game data and screens, allowing for interactive multiplayer experiences while preventing cheating by only revealing card faces to authorized players.

AI summary

A gaming system for card games is provided. The gaming system includes a plurality of gaming cards and a processor. Each of the gaming cards has a recognition code. The processor is configured to: generate a correspondence between the recognition codes of the gaming cards and a plurality of card faces; obtain an image of the gaming card placed in a recognition area captured by an image capturing device; recognize the recognition code in the image to generate game data according to a recognition result and the correspondence; and generate a game screen to be displayed by a display according to the game data. In addition, a gaming table is also provided.
